Everybody ...!!

I have query regarding ASP.NET.

i want make one aspx page in which can upload an image. and want to use
different types of tools which is supported by asp.net for upload an image and store in
database which provide some validation like not 2 MB photo is valid or if photo size is large then
it provide some low resolution

i am very new in this technology.

pls help me or give me ur valuable suggestion ...!!

